Time of Update: 2015-07-16
標籤:移動互連網 app so保護 app安全雲 安卓手機APP的安全一直是是移動互連網不停歇的話題,不僅使得開發人員壓力倍增,也讓使用者也憂心忡忡。應用APP的現狀是: 移動互連網的呼聲越來越高,安卓手機的效能不斷提高,
Time of Update: 2015-07-16
標籤:android之所以做了這麼一個Demo,是因為最近項目中有一個奇葩的需求:使用者拍攝照片後,分享到的同時添加備忘,想擷取使用者在的彈出框輸入的內容,儲存在自己的伺服器上。而事實上,這個內容程式是無法擷取的,因此採取了一個折衷方案,將文字直接寫在圖片上。首先上Demo: 功能:1.使用者自由輸入內容,可手動換行,並且行滿也會自動換行。2.可拖動改變圖片中文本位置(文字不會超出圖片地區)。3.點擊“產生圖片”按鈕之後,產生一張帶有文字的圖片檔案。代碼不多,直接全部貼上了
Time of Update: 2015-07-16
標籤: 小晴天老師系列——蘋果大豐收Problem Description小晴天的後花園有好多好多的蘋果樹,某天,蘋果大豐收~小晴天總共摘了M個蘋果,我們假設蘋果之間是不可分辨的。為了儲存蘋果,小晴天買了N個一模一樣的箱子,想要把蘋果放進去,允許有的箱子是空的,請問小晴天有多少種不同的放法呢?例如對於4個蘋果,3個箱子,2+1+1和1+2+1和1+1+2
Time of Update: 2015-07-16
標籤:麥子學院【www.maiziedu.com】乾貨 | iOS開發人員需要的九大設計工具1.AppCooker AppCooker是一款方便的iPad應用。它能夠提供可點擊的原型模板,集合了所有需要編碼或渲染的重要組件,並且還可以協助開發人員無需任何代碼編寫就能夠構思、設計和測試iOS應用。目前AppCooker在App Store上的售價為19.99美元。 主要功能: 全功能模型編輯器擁有所有iOS UI組件 位元影像圖畫、向量形狀和文本工具 帶有連結的整體螢幕視圖
Time of Update: 2015-07-16
標籤:做項目需要打包成jar檔案供第三方使用項目要求(將圖片文字資源寫到到jar包中,第三方調用時,僅須要在AndroidManifest.xml配置下對應的Activity通過StartActivity方式拉起Activity):在網上找了好久。並依靠查看Android原始碼終於攻克了問題一:須要明確知識:1.APK中的Res檔案夾無法通過Eclipse的Export方式匯入到jar包中而Assert能夠2.Android程式在編譯成APK時須要通過aapt將Res檔案夾下的資源產生相應的Id
Time of Update: 2015-07-16
標籤:ListView android android開發 什麼是Volley?在這之前,我們在程式中需要和網路通訊的時候,大體使用的東西莫過於AsyncTaskLoader,HttpURLConnection,AsyncTask,HTTPClient(Apache)等,2013年的GoogleI/O大會上,Volley發布了。Volley是Android平台上的網路通訊庫,能使網路通訊更快,更
Time of Update: 2015-07-16
標籤:在iOS開發過程中,不管是做什麼應用,都會碰到資料儲存的問題。將資料儲存到本地,能夠讓程式的運行更加流暢,不會出現讓人厭惡的菊花形狀,使得使用者體驗更好。下面介紹一下資料儲存的方式:1.NSKeyedArchiver:採用歸檔的形式來儲存資料,該資料對象需要遵守NSCoding協議,並且該對象對應的類必須提供encodeWithCoder:和initWithCoder:方法。前一個方法告訴系統怎麼對對象進行編碼,而後一個方法則是告訴系統怎麼對對象進行解碼。例如對Possession對象歸檔
Time of Update: 2015-07-16
標籤: 最近的工作項目,需要使用cordova外掛程式開發,詳細Cordova角色,不會走,你可以去百度自身OK該,直接啟動。詳細過程,我有一個小Demo解說提前進行。還只是接觸,東西太理論基礎,我也不太清楚,或啟動和上升Demo,去的動力~大家多多不吝賜教~ Step1.準備工作:
Time of Update: 2015-07-16
標籤:最近在寫代碼的時候感覺block有的時候真的很好用,傳值、傳遞訊息跟代理通知比起來真的是很快,特別是一些空間的點擊事件回呼函數int (^myBlock)(int) = ^(int num){ return num; };
Time of Update: 2015-07-16
標籤: 最近在看了許多關於dp-px,px-dp,sp-px,px-sp之間轉化的博文,過去我比較常用的方式是: 1 //轉換dip為px 2 public static int convertDipOrPx(Context context, int dip) { 3 float scale = context.getResources().getDisplayMetrics().density; 4 return (int)(dip*scale +
Time of Update: 2015-07-16
標籤:Html5喊了好多年了,至今仍沒有被大規模的使用。依然記得2012年參加HTML5夢工廠(現在叫iWeb峰會)去了好多人,當時天真的以為,Html5真的開始流行起來了,於是就在會場賣書的地方買了本Html5的書來學。後來,大家知道的,Html5都是不溫不火,但是我卻沒有減少對其關注的熱情。由於我一直做移動APP的開發,多終端同一套邏輯開發多次不說,同時開發人員還要和UI和產品多次溝通來實現,身為App開發人員,這裡面的苦,我有發言權。所以,特別希望看見一款跨平台的Framework能Cov
Time of Update: 2015-07-16
標籤:本文只是記錄一下如何在自己的電腦上配置APNS推送環境,其它的如推送的原理,流程什麼的這裡就不寫了。 一. 去Apple 開發人員中心,建立App ID。注意App ID不能使用萬用字元。並注意添加Push Notification Service 對於已經建立的APP ID,也可以編輯給他添加Push Notification Service二. 建立development 和
Time of Update: 2015-07-16
標籤:跨平台開發行動裝置 App開發對很多開發人員來說是一種令人恐懼的事情。許多企業希望能夠通過開發行動裝置 App程式,來提升企業業務水平,開發原生App時往往又缺少專業的Objective C 或 Java
Time of Update: 2015-07-16
標籤:error: No resource identifier found for attribute in custom-views from http://developer.android.com原來:<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
Time of Update: 2015-07-16
標籤:一、在Android中,發送和處理http請求實在太常見了,以至於我們經常需要寫這方面的代碼。Android中網路互動的代碼不能在UI線程中執行,只能在額外的子線程中執行。我一般的做法是通過建立子線程和Handler來完成,網路互動的代碼線上程中執行,互動的結果通過Handler反饋給UI線程。new Thread(){ public void run() { //http請求的發送與接收代碼
Time of Update: 2015-07-16
標籤:在這裡小編學習了查看網狀圖片的小案例,: 初始介面: 點擊瀏覽後,效果如下: 需要注意的是 該案例需要擷取連網許可權,即: <uses-permission android:name="android.permission.INTERNET"/> 具體步驟如下:1.定義並初始化控制項:private EditText etImageUrl; private ImageView ivImage;/**控制項初始化*/ private void
Time of Update: 2015-07-16
標籤:在ObjC中使用@protocol定義一組方法規範,實現此協議的類必須實現對應的方法。熟悉物件導向的童鞋都知道介面本身是對象行為描述的協議規範。也就是說在ObjC中@protocol和其他語言的介面定義是類似的,只是在ObjC中interface關鍵字已經用於定義類了,因此它不會再像C#、Java中使用interface定義介面了。假設我們定義了一個動物的協議AnimalDelegate,人員Person這個類需要實現這個協議,請看下面的代碼:AnimalDelegate.h////
Time of Update: 2015-07-16
標籤: iOS的應用程式的生命週期,還有程式是運行在前台還是後台,應用程式各個狀態的變換,這些對於開發人員來說都是很重要的。 iOS系統的資源是有限的,應用程式在前台和在背景狀態是不一樣的。在後台時,程式會受到系統的很多限制,這樣可以提高電池的使用和使用者體驗。//開發app,我們要遵循apple公司的一些指導原則,原則如下:1、應用程式的狀態狀態如下:Not running 未運行 程式沒啟動Inactive 未啟用
Time of Update: 2015-07-16
標籤:一、
Time of Update: 2015-07-16
標籤: 介紹 LogCat是Eclipse裡面做Android開發的工具包ADT中的一個工具,用來查看和過濾Android日誌系統的輸出。 開啟LogCat 進入Eclipse,選擇Window菜單,然後選擇Show View子功能表,最後再選則other子功能表,在開啟的Show View對話方塊中選擇Android分組中的LogCat,雙擊它或者點擊OK,就能開啟LogCat面板。 連上真機後LogCat不顯示日誌的問題